摘要:

目的:探究NLRP3炎症小体(NACHT, LRR and PYD domains-containing protein 3 inflammasome)和胱天蛋白酶-1(cysteinyl aspartate specific proteinase,Caspase-1)在颞下颌关节骨关节炎(temporomandibular joint osteoarthritis,TMJOA)患者滑膜细胞中的表达。方法:分离人颞下颌关节滑膜组织并进行滑膜细胞培养,另取3例髁突肥大患者的滑膜组织作为对照组。实时定量聚合酶链式反应(real-time quantitative polymerase chain reaction,RT-PCR)法检测滑膜细胞中NLRP3和Caspase-1的基因表达,Western blot检测滑膜细胞中NLRP3和Caspase-1的表达。结果:TMJOA患者滑膜细胞中的NLRP3和Caspase-1的表达显著高于对照组(P<0.05)。结论:NLRP3和Caspase-1在TMJOA滑膜细胞中高表达,说明它们与TMJOA发生发展密切相关,这将有助于进一步阐明其分子机制。

关键词: 颞下颌关节骨关节炎, 滑膜, NLRP3炎性小体, 半胱氨酸蛋白酶-1

Abstract:

Objective: To investigate the expression of NLRP3(NACHT, LRR and PYD domains-containing protein 3 inflammasome) and Caspase-1 in the synovium of temporomandibular joint osteoarthritis(TMJOA). Methods: Synovial tissues were collected from TMJ of patients and synovial cells were cultured. Synovial tissues of three patients with condylar hypertrophy were taken as control group. Real-time PCR was used to examine the gene expression of NLRP3 and Caspase-1 in synovial cells. The protein expressions of NLRP3 and Caspase-1 in synovial cells were detected by Western blot. Results: The expressions of NLRP3 and Caspase-1 in the synovial cells of TMJOA were significantly increased than the control group(P<0.05). Conclusion: NLRP3 and Caspase-1 were increased in the synovial cells of TMJOA and closely related to the occurrence and development of TMJOA, which will help to further clarify its molecular mechanism.

Key words: temporomandibular joint osteoarthritis, synovium, NLRP3 inflammasome, Caspase-1
